
Veeam successfully concluded its ProPartner Summit 2025 at Marriott Resort & Spa, Jaisalmer, from February 20 to 22, 2025, bringing together 45 channel partners from 41 organizations along with industry leaders. The event focused on strategic networking, innovation, and collaboration, shaping Veeam’s growth strategy in India & SAARC. Discussions aligned with India’s “Viksit Bharat” vision, emphasizing data protection, cybersecurity, and digital infrastructure to support the nation’s goal of becoming a developed economy by 2047. With a strong focus on cloud adoption and partner collaboration, Veeam is poised to drive digital transformation and security across the region in the years ahead.
Celebrating Partner Excellence: Jaisalmer Jewels Night
A key highlight was the “Jaisalmer Jewels Night” awards ceremony, where Veeam honored top-performing channel partners for their outstanding contributions in 2024. This recognition underscored the importance of Veeam’s partner ecosystem in driving data resilience amid increasing cyber threats.

Data Resiliency in a Box: Veeam's Commitment to Zero Data Loss
VARINDIA explored the data protection strategies Veeam adopts and the India specific initiatives, in a chit chat with Mr. Sandeep Bhambure, VP & MD, Veeam India & SAARC
Veeam's strategy for zero data loss is centered around five key pillars: data protection, data recovery, data security, data portability, and artificial intelligence. These elements work in tandem to provide businesses with an end-to-end solution for safeguarding their critical information.
Data Protection: Organizations invest heavily in securing their data, and Veeam ensures that data is protected at all times with the most advanced backup and recovery mechanisms.
Data Recovery: Veeam enables businesses to restore data at the click of a button, ensuring that operations resume seamlessly.
Data Security: In alignment with Zero Trust architecture, Veeam enhances security by enabling immutable backups and preventing cyber threats from corrupting stored data.
Data Portability: With 75% of organizations facing ransomware attacks in the past year, the ability to recover data from an immutable copy is critical. Veeam ensures that data can be restored to a hosted site, a secondary location, or even a hyperscaler cloud environment, making recovery flexible and efficient.
Artificial Intelligence: Veeam has integrated AI into its platform to detect malware proactively, automate recovery, and ensure that reinfections do not occur during the restoration process.
Disaster Recovery Without Disruptions
One of the primary concerns for organizations is ensuring disaster recovery testing without affecting production workloads. At the time of recovery, businesses fear reinfection of their clean data, with studies showing that 56% of companies worry about recovering compromised files. Veeam mitigates this by offering an isolated sandbox to test immutable backups for malware using AI-powered detection like inline entropy analysis, ensuring secure restoration.
Industries like healthcare, finance, and manufacturing rely on Veeam to prevent breaches. Companies such as Mahindra & Mahindra, Hero MotoCorp, and MIT University have strengthened data resiliency, cutting recovery windows by 50% and reducing costs. Veeam ensures seamless, secure recovery, safeguarding business continuity with advanced data protection solutions.
Best Practices for CSOs
As enterprises shift from VMware to alternate hypervisors, migration complexity remains a challenge. Veeam simplifies this with a universally restorable backup format, enabling seamless workload migration across Hyper-V, cloud, or physical servers with minimal effort.
Data protection is now a boardroom priority, driving collaboration between CSOs and CIOs. Veeam’s Zero Trust-aligned solutions integrate security and backup, ensuring compliance and resilience. A common myth is that cloud workloads don’t need backups, yet Microsoft and AWS recommend third-party protection. Veeam safeguards data across on-prem, hybrid, and cloud environments, ensuring continuous availability and rapid recovery.
